Calculate Log Base 401 of 122

To solve the equation log 401 (122)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 122, a = 401:
    log 401 (122) = log(122) / log(401)
  3. Evaluate the term:
    log(122) / log(401)
    = 1.39794000867204 / 1.92427928606188
    = 0.80147680344549
